About the role:

The SAP Platform Lead, aka Staff Enterprise Technology Engineer, is a senior member of the SAP Platforms leadership team. The role shares accountability for the strategy, engineering, delivery and operational performance of bp’s SAP platform estate across on-premises, private cloud, public cloud and SaaS services.
 

The role combines hands-on technical leadership with portfolio ownership, people leadership, financial stewardship, supplier management, risk governance and executive engagement. It leads complex decisions across SAP S4 RISE, on premise ECCs & BWs, S4 Public, SAP Business AI Platform (BTP) and Joule, integration, data and analytics platforms, engineering toolchains, test automation, observability, application lifecycle management and the wider SAP technology ecosystem.
 

This is deliberately broader than a specialist engineering role. The successful candidate will dynamically take more ownership of major SAP platform accountabilities, deputise for the Principal Enterprise Technology Engineer when required.

What you will need to be successful:

  • Extensive experience leading SAP platform engineering squads/teams, operations and transformation delivery within a large, complex global enterprise environment.
  • Strong hands-on technical background in SAP technologies, including SAP Basis, SAP technical architecture, SAP BTP, SAP integration technologies, cloud connectivity, identity and access management, platform operations and enterprise-scale SAP landscapes.
  • Significant experience designing, operating and modernising SAP workloads across public cloud, private cloud and on-premise environments, including AWS, Azure, SAP RISE and hybrid architectures.
  • Demonstrable experience delivering major SAP transformation initiatives involving SAP S/4HANA, BTP, SAP cloud services, Business AI, Joule and enterprise-scale digital transformation programmes.
  • Consistent record of working with globally distributed technology teams, managed service providers and strategic technology partners.
  • Demonstrated ownership of business-critical technology services, including operational performance, resilience, disaster recovery, cyber security, compliance and risk management.
  • Shown accountability for technology budgets, investment planning, commercial governance, software licensing, supplier performance and vendor management.
  • Solid experience being a great partner with SAP, SI Partners and other strategic technology providers, including contract negotiations, critical issues, service reviews and value optimisation.
  • Recognised SAP technology authority with an established professional network across SAP customers, user groups, industry forums, partners and SAP product organisations, with a reputation for influencing strategy, product direction and industry guidelines.
  • Demonstrated experience identifying, shaping and implementing AI, automation and emerging SAP technologies to deliver measurable business value and operational improvements.
  • Solid ability to influence senior business, technology and supplier partners, translate technical complexity into business outcomes and lead complex multi-functional decisions.
